Painting/drawing students can enjoy classes conducted in spacious studios complete with high ceilings and large windows that provide plenty of natural light. A variety of media and approaches are taught to help students achieve the control and understanding necessary to produce quality work. Bio: David Tammany was born in Wichita, Kansas. He received a BFA from Wichita State University, Wichita, Kansas, and a MFA from Tulane University, New Orleans, Louisiana. He began teaching at EMU in 1966. Recent publications, exhibitions and/or presentations:
